The Poorest Neighborhood in the City

Northern Mozambique holds 9 unreached people groups–that we know about. One of them, the Mwani, live in the northern-most port city and provincial capital. God has been raising up workers for the past few decades now, to reach out to the Mwani. Most recently, he has strategically placed two new families into Mwani areas in the city. The Mwani populate two of the poorest, most congested, areas of the town. So bad are the conditions that all supplies are hand carried–there are no roads! When it rains, many lose their belongings in the torrents which rush down the mountain-slope into their valley. Pray that these Mwani would turn to the only true anchor of souls–Jesus!

Report from Patrick who works with the Mwani in Northern Mocambique, Sheepfold Ministries…
23 missionaries are now scatterd among the Mwani.(14 Westerners and 9 Africans) through 6 organisations. There are different ministry approaches…radio,chronological narratives, sports ministry,nursery school and jesus film. there are presently 24 believers scattered from Ibo to Mocimboa. please pray for unity among missionaries. Please pray that God would bring in thousands and that the seed which has been sewn for years may bear fruit.
